RESTING PLACES On Wounds, War and the Irish Revolution

A powerful, moving book about the heaviness of history land a reckoning with what reconciliation can mean in the present. To read it is to walk with ghosts, to time-travel, to sit with the grandchild of the Irish civil war as she navigates intergenerational trauma. A story told with deep live, empathy and a desire for healing. I am not the same after reading it. CLAIRE MITCHELL

This is a work of eloquent, haunting beauty, a song of touring and revelation that deserves the widest possible audience. This is a story rooted in a place and time, but it is truly the story of all wars in all times. FERGAL KEANE

Ellen McWilliams unlocks the layers of her intergenerational, untold story of revolution and silences embedded deep in West Cork. A Brave, eloquent, ans personal account by a literary scholarship who has already contributed to and the recovery of other Irish women writers' untold narratives of kinship, exile, secrets and displacement. LINDA CONNOLLY

Written in more sorrow than in anger, Ellen McWilliams's meditations on history, memory and the legacies of atrocity add up to a remarkable conversion between the past and the present, and between silence and articulation. FINTAN O'TOOLE

A rich and complex book, partly a hymn in praise of the writers family and the locale in West Cork from which they and she sprang, partly a memoir of the writer's own life, and partly a meditation on violence and hurt in West Cork during the Irish War of Independence and the civil War that followed. CARLO GÉBLER
